## Deploying the Gatewick Proctor Queue

Deploys are pretty painless: push to main, wait for the pipeline, then watch the queue drain dashboard for five minutes. If candidates pile up mid-exam, roll back first and ask questions later — the queue replays safely. Everything the workers care about lives in one config block, shown here for reference.

settings of bafof-yagef:
JOROX_PIN=8740
JOROX_TENANT=pelox
JOROX_METRICS_HOST=metrics.jorox.qorvelworks.internal
JOROX_SEAL=seal_c78f63c1
JOROX_STANDBY_TEAM=norax

Step 4: Migrate the Gildhall seat-map renderer to the tiled layout engine. Delete the legacy polygon cache first; it conflicts with tile indices. Run the fixture suite against the Orpheline stage plan before promoting. Once tests pass, replace the renderer's startup settings with the values that follow.

settings of fafog-haduf:
ZORIX_PIN=4648
ZORIX_METRICS_HOST=metrics.zorix.paliqsys.corp
ZORIX_LOG_LEVEL=info
ZORIX_TENANT=druix

Heads up, new folks: in Coldvault 3.2 we renamed the old `FREEZE_TOKEN` setting — it confused everyone because it had nothing to do with freezing, it authenticates archive pushes to the Glacierline buckets. The archiver in the Norwick cluster already uses the new name, so older runbooks are stale. Update your local .env by replacing the old entry with this line:

vault entry, yahaf-tagug: LEDGER_TOKEN20=884d77d1a8b98aa4edfb

Subject: DR drill next Thursday — ScrubJay EXIF pipeline

Hi all, quick heads-up for the security review: next Thursday we're running the disaster-recovery drill for ScrubJay, the service that strips EXIF metadata from uploaded images before they hit the Petrel CDN. We'll simulate a full loss of the scrubbing cluster and fail over to the cold standby in the Marrowgate region. The standby vault will be sealed at drill start, so whoever's driving will need to unseal it with the recovery passphrase noted below.

vault phrase of tajop-haduf = holath-brivan-wenax